**Short description** Deploy an autonomous quadruped robot to patrol construction sites, monitor restricted areas, detect hazards, and improve job site security and operational awareness. **Overview** Enhance construction site security and operational visibility with an autonomous quadruped patrol robot capable of navigating active job sites, uneven terrain, partially completed structures, and difficult outdoor environments. Designed for construction companies, infrastructure operators, industrial developers, and large-scale commercial projects, this robotic patrol solution provides a modern approach to site monitoring, hazard inspection, and perimeter awareness. Using onboard AI navigation systems, computer vision, obstacle avoidance, and autonomous patrol routing, the robot can continuously monitor designated areas while identifying unusual activity, unauthorized access, open safety risks, equipment abnormalities, or environmental hazards. Its quadruped mobility platform allows it to traverse surfaces and environments that are often difficult for traditional wheeled robots, including gravel, mud, ramps, debris, and unfinished pathways. This service is ideal for overnight patrols, remote site monitoring, safety inspections, perimeter patrol operations, equipment zone checks, and large construction projects requiring continuous visibility without placing human personnel in potentially hazardous conditions. The robot may also assist with progress documentation, thermal inspection workflows, or remote teleoperation support depending on deployment configuration. The deployment includes robot setup, patrol calibration, autonomous route configuration, and operational support if required. Custom patrol schedules, restricted-zone monitoring workflows, and site-specific inspection objectives may also be configured depending on buyer requirements. Availability, runtime duration, and autonomy performance may vary based on terrain complexity, weather conditions, lighting conditions, and overall site size.
